The aerospace industry is undergoing a seismic shift, driven by SpaceX's relentless innovation in satellite deployment. By 2025, the company has cemented its dominance in the global launch market, accounting for 57% of all satellite launches in Q2 2025 and 71% of commercial space revenue. This leadership is not merely a function of scale but a strategic redefinition of infrastructure in the space economy. SpaceX's Falcon 9 rocket, with its 80% cost reduction compared to traditional systems, has democratized access to orbit, enabling a cascade of economic and technological advancements across connectivity, defense, and emerging tech sectors.

The Infrastructure Revolution: Cost, Scale, and Reusability

SpaceX's reusable rocket technology has slashed launch costs from $62 million in 2020 to $12 million in 2025, a metric that underscores its disruptive edge. This efficiency has fueled a 140% increase in launch cadence compared to 2024, with 170 launches projected for 2025. The company's ability to deploy 1,200 satellites annually—far outpacing competitors like Amazon's Project Kuiper and OneWeb—has created a defensible moat in the $1 trillion space economy.

The implications are profound. SpaceX's Starlink V2 Mini satellites, operating at 525–535 km altitude with laser inter-satellite links, now deliver 25ms latency and 95% faster connectivity than traditional systems. This has unlocked a $28 billion market in high-latitude and remote regions, where terrestrial infrastructure is sparse. Investors should note that Starlink's revenue surged to $11.8 billion in 2025, a 53% year-over-year increase, with breakeven EBITDA expected by 2026.

Defense and National Security: A Strategic Partnership Play

SpaceX's expansion into defense is reshaping national security infrastructure. The $3 billion Starshield program, an encrypted variant of Starlink, now supports U.S. military operations in high-latitude and contested environments. By 2025, the U.S. Space Force's MILNET initiative—a hybrid mesh network combining commercial and military satellites—relies on SpaceX's constellation for secure, real-time communication.

The Proliferated Low Earth Orbit (PLEO) Satellite-Based Services program, a $13 billion IDIQ contract, further solidifies SpaceX's role in battlefield support. These contracts, coupled with the deployment of 480+ Starshield satellites, highlight the company's transition from a commercial player to a critical infrastructure provider for global defense. For investors, this diversification into defense contracts offers a buffer against market volatility and underscores long-term revenue stability.

Cascading Effects on Emerging Tech and Telecom

The ripple effects of SpaceX's infrastructure investments are reshaping industries. In telecom, partnerships like T-Mobile's Direct-to-Cell (DTC) service—which allows smartphones to connect directly to Starlink satellites—threaten to disrupt the $1.2 trillion global telecom sector. With 1.8 million testers already enrolled, DTC could redefine connectivity in rural and disaster-stricken areas.

Moreover, SpaceX's laser-linked satellites and quantum inertial navigation systems (tested via the X-37B OTV-8 mission) are pushing the boundaries of 5G convergence and autonomous systems. These advancements position SpaceX as a key enabler for industries ranging from autonomous vehicles to AI-driven logistics.

Investment Implications: A Long-Term Play on Space Infrastructure

For investors, SpaceX's dominance in satellite deployment signals a shift from speculative bets to infrastructure-driven growth. The global space infrastructure market, valued at $148.8 billion in 2024, is projected to reach $307.41 billion by 2032 at a 9.68% CAGR. Key sectors to watch include:
- Aerospace manufacturing: Companies supplying components for reusable rockets and satellites.
- Orbital logistics: Firms enabling satellite maintenance and in-space refueling.
- Defense tech: Providers of secure communication systems and quantum navigation.

However, risks remain. Regulatory challenges, competition from emerging players like Rocket LabRKLB-- and Blue Origin, and the environmental impact of space debris could temper growth. Yet, SpaceX's first-mover advantage, technical superiority, and strategic partnerships with governments and tech giants create a compelling case for long-term investment.
